Step-by-Step Scania Injector Installation Guide
To ensure proper performance, follow a structured process.
1. Preliminary Diagnostics
Before removing the injector:
Scan ECU for fault codes
Perform return flow test
Check scania injector pump pressure
Why diagnose first? Because sometimes the issue is not the injector but the scania injector pump or rail pressure sensor.
2. Safe Removal
Use the proper scania injector tool to:
Avoid cylinder head damage
Prevent injector body distortion
Maintain sealing integrity
3. Seat Cleaning & Preparation
Clean injector seat thoroughly
Replace copper sealing washer
Inspect O-rings
Skipping this step is one of the most common causes of compression leakage.
4. Torque Application
Use manufacturer-specified torque values. Over-tightening can damage threads; under-tightening may cause leaks.
Injector Coding and Calibration
After physical installation, electronic calibration is mandatory.
What Is Scania Injector Code?
Each scania injector is manufactured with unique flow characteristics. The scania injector code tells the ECU how to compensate for small production tolerances.
Coding Procedure
Connect diagnostic device.
Enter the new injector code.
Reset fuel adaptation values.
Perform live data verification.
If coding is skipped, you may experience:
Rough idle
Increased fuel consumption
Emission-related fault codes
XPI vs HPI Calibration Differences
Different systems require different approaches.
XPI Scania Injector
The xpi scania injector system operates at extremely high pressures and demands precise calibration. Often used in:
scania euro 5 injector engines
injector scania euro 6 platforms
Even minor calibration errors can affect emission compliance.
Scania HPI Injector
The scania hpi injector system is mechanically simpler but still requires proper coding and torque precision.
Understanding which system your engine uses is critical before calibration.

Scania Injector Pump and System Balance
A properly calibrated injector still depends on a stable scania injector pump.
If pump pressure fluctuates:
Injection timing becomes unstable
Fuel quantity may vary
Engine performance drops
Before concluding that the injector is faulty, always verify pump and rail system integrity.
